We are an organization of shooters who shoot hand cast lead alloy bullets for both target competition and hunting.
The Washtenaw Cast Bullet Shooters conducts bench rest rifle
matches monthly March through October. There are many
classifications to allow everyone to participate in their form
of matches with their rifle or handgun. We have classifications
for jacketed bullets, hunter class pistols
(Revolvers & TC Contenders)New
for 2009 - The Top Gun Competition. Compete in our matches and
earn points toward the illustrious Top Gun Trophy. Pints are
earned in each match based the the percentage of record in each
of the 4 matches. 10 shot groups at 100 yards, Score at 100
yards, Score at 200 yards and 100/200 yard Score Aggregate.
Everyone is welcome to come and compete, any rifle, any ammo. We
even have a class for those wishing to use a revolver. (.357 and
up).

We have informal practice sessions where we practice our
marksmanship, exchange ideas and help those that are interested
become better shooters. These are usually conducted weekly on
either Thursdays and/or Tuesdays. If you are interested in shooting
cast bullets, there is no better place to learn.
